Abstract

The utility model relates to a diameter changing inner mould for forming large diameter steel reinforced concrete pipes, comprising inner mould barrel body with a gap (4). The barrel body is provided with two equidistant movable pull corners (2) in a welding way, and the two pull corners are respectively hinged with two connecting plates (3) which are hinged with a power pull rod (5) whose end part is fixedly provided with a movable strip plate (1). The inner mould is used for producing large diameter steel reinforced concrete pipes, and the utility model has the advantages of less equipment investment, low energy consumption, no waste slurry and no nuisance. Because the utility model uses power and diameter changing modes to make demoulding, the bulky manual work is saved, and the utility model can be used for processing a plurality of large diameter pipes.

Description

Diameter changing inner mould for forming large diameter steel reinforced concrete pipe
The utility model relates to large diameter concrete pipe shaping mould, particularly diameter, and (be particularly suitable for producing φ 1000mm-φ 5000mm, length is 2000mm greater than the reducing internal mold of 1000mm pipe of concrete; 2500mm; 3000mm; 5000mm) heavy caliber concrete drain tile.
At present, centrifugal process is mostly adopted in the large diameter concrete pipe moulding, and its shortcoming is: investment is big, energy consumption is high, noise is big, throw away a large amount of useless mortar in the big tuber forming process, contaminated environment, the second pipe of cement factory is an example with Beijing, the mortar sediment of producing 100 kilometers pipe of cements generations is up to more than 3000 tons, become a great problem of enterprise, and the pipe of concrete presentation quality of making is poor, the outer wall ixoderm, wall reveals stone and runs slurry, therefore, is necessary to provide a kind of novel mould.
The purpose of this utility model provides that a kind of investment is little, and energy consumption is low, and is easy to operate, and the concrete reinforced pipe inside and outside wall after the moulding is smooth, external pressure strength is higher than centrifugal process.
For achieving the above object, the utility model is by the following technical solutions: the reducing internal mold equipment that is used for moulding heavy caliber concrete reinforced pipe comprises: the internal mold cylindrical shell that has breach, the angle is drawn in two equidistant activities of welding on the cylindrical shell, two draw the angle hinged with two connecting plates respectively, two connecting plates and power pull bar are hinged, and tie rod end is fixed a movable batten.
The utility model is described in further detail below in conjunction with accompanying drawing:
Fig. 1: a kind of reducing internal mold front view that is used for moulding heavy caliber concrete reinforced pipe
The side view of Fig. 2: Fig. 1
Fig. 3: the enlarged drawing of A among Fig. 2
Among Fig. 1, Fig. 2, Fig. 3,4 have the internal mold cylindrical shell of breach, and two equidistant activities of welding draw angle 2, two to draw the angle hinged with two connecting plates 3 respectively on the cylindrical shell, and two connecting plates and cylinder plunger primary push rod 5 are hinged, and a movable batten 1 is fixed in the primary push rod end.Among the figure, 6 is hydraulic cylinder, 7 be pin except the cylinder plunger primary push rod, can also use power pull bars such as electric pushrod, screw thread pull bar.
Operating process: this internal mold can be used with the external mold with monolateral opening linkage locking structure, before the demoulding, movable batten and internal mold circle wall connect flat, draw the angle parallel, when connecting plate was spent less than 180 owing to the effect of hydraulic cylinder, the batten on the internal mold was drawn out of, and the internal mold girth is contracted, after the length that the internal mold girth is shortened multiply by 1/ (π), the just interior reduced length of mode diameter.Otherwise hydraulic cylinder advances, because the connecting plate effect draws the angle to be open, connecting plate becomes 180 degree, and batten is filled in internal mold cylindrical shell indentation, there and restored.Internal mold generally got final product the demoulding according to pipe diameter size and jelling time difference at 30-120 minute, prolong demould time and can guarantee the smooth of bell and spigot, and can eliminate pore and crackle.
The utility model advantage: small investment, energy consumption is low, for example producing φ 2600mm, length 3000mm pipe of concrete, hydraulic variable diameter vibration moulding only needs 7 kilowatts (originally needing 132 kilowatts), there is not useless mortar, do not have public hazards, owing to adopt hydraulic variable diameter, external mold adopts monolateral opening locking, inside and outside moulding/demoulding is easy, saves heavy muscle power Work, all work only needs 3-4 people to finish, and can be used for producing the drainpipe of bell and spigot, also can produce the tongue and groove drainpipe, fixable type is produced, also can flow-type production, after each production cycle, can continue, the pipe of newborn output is in original place steam curing, or do not have the steam natural maintenance.
